During his time with Gods and Toe Fat, Ken Hensley recorded this album for a specific project called Head Machine. At this time, Hensley played mainly guitar again, as in the beginning of his career. The producer of the album "Orgasm" was David Paramor, who also produced The Gods' albums.
The music is pwerful hard psych, and the style is something between The Gods and Toe Fat. Hensley describes this project as a "mercenary" one, which means that they were involved only for the money, professionally speaking. He states that it wasn't really his band, and there are some doubts about the songwriting credits, since on the album it's written that Paramor composed all the songs, but there's definitely a "Ken Hensley touch" on them. It is one of the heaviest records that Hensley has ever been involved. Musically it veers towards heavy rock with most tracks being pretty 'hard' with driving guitar work. The title cut and 'Climax' are the pick of the bunch, whilst 'Make The Feeling Last' and 'The Girl Who Loved', are softer and subtler numbers. Lyrically (if it isn't obvious from the titles) the album basically deals with sex...
Overall, a good example of the heavier rock genre which was quite prevalent in the late sixties / early seventies. Two tracks, 'I Can't Believe' and 'You Tried to Take it All' were later re-recorded for Toe Fat's debut album released a year after HEAD MACHINE'S ORGASM.
* Ken Leslie (Ken Hensley) - organ/piano/guitar/vocals
* John Leadhen (John Glascock) - bass guitar
* Brian and Lee Poole (Brian Glascock and Lee Kerslake) - drums
* Mike Road (?) - percussion
